Formula 1 racing stable Haas will throw himself particularly in shell at the upcoming Grand Prix of Japan. On Monday, the team presented a special paint with which Esteban Ocon and Oliver Bearman will be traveling in Suzuka.

The Haas, which is otherwise rather simple, gets for the Formula 1 race in Japanese Suzuka (including live on free TV at RTL) a fresh coat of paint. On Monday, the team showed first recordings of a new special paint that will decorate the VF-25 in the upcoming race.

The painting is based on the so-called Sakura season that started in Japan. The pictures of the leaves of the flowering cherry trees will now be seen on the Haas. In addition, the Haas logo on the side boxes gets a pink touch.

Haas one of the surprises of the Formula 1 season

Meanwhile, it is expected with great excitement how the US racing team will present itself in Suzuka at the race weekend. After Ocon and Bearman did not really get going at the Chaos race in Melbourne, they set a big exclamation mark in Shanghai a week later.

The Frenchman, who (also due to the Ferrari Disqualifications), sensationally presented himself to fifth place and joined ten points (also due to the Ferrari Disqualifications). Rookie Bearman also showed an impressive performance and improved from starting place 17 to eighth place.

Haas brought the strong performance into a comfortable starting point in the constructors world championship. Here the team with 14 points is now in sixth place. Of the so-called midfield teams, only Williams has more points on the account (17).
